How do local Pennsylvania weather patterns impact your chimney structure in Hatfield, PA?

The unique Mid-Atlantic climate of Hatfield, PA subjects masonry chimneys to severe seasonal stress that demands vigilant, year-round preventive care. Heavy winter snowfalls followed by sudden spring thaws create a relentless cycle where water penetrates porous bricks and mortar crowns. A reliable Chimney Sweep near me in Hatfield, PA search often spikes in late autumn as residents prepare for freezing temperatures, but proactive maintenance should actually occur well before the first frost. During humid Pennsylvania summers, trapped moisture mixes with leftover soot inside uncleaned flues, accelerating acidic corrosion of metal dampers and brick liners. What does a thorough chimney inspection involve for homeowners in Hatfield, PA?

A comprehensive chimney inspection is a detailed diagnostic evaluation designed to uncover hidden structural flaws and dangerous creosote build-up before they threaten your Hatfield, PA household. Professional chimney inspections typically range from basic Level 1 visual checks of readily accessible areas to advanced Level 2 video scans that peer deep inside concealed flue walls. For residents living near Souderton, PA or Ambler, PA, these routine evaluations are essential for verifying that heating systems comply with local fire codes and manufacturer specifications. During an inspection, our licensed specialists examine the crown, flashing, damper, smoke chamber, and firebox for signs of cracking, spalling, or rust. Catching minor deterioration early eliminates the need for expensive masonry rebuilds down the road. How can customized chimney caps and dampers protect your Hatfield, PA flue all year round?

Customized chimney caps and tightly sealing dampers act as the ultimate first line of defense for homes throughout Hatfield, PA against invasive wildlife, debris, and damaging moisture. A specialized Chimney Sweep Hatfield, PA expert knows that standard off-the-shelf caps often fail to withstand heavy local winds or keep out aggressive squirrels and nesting birds common in Montgomery County woodlands. Installing a heavy-duty stainless steel or copper chimney cap prevents rainwater from pooling on your masonry crown while allowing optimal smoke exhaust. Meanwhile, upgrading to a top-sealing damper stops conditioned indoor air from escaping up the flue when your fireplace is not in use, significantly lowering seasonal heating bills. What essential maintenance schedule should Hatfield, PA homeowners follow for optimal chimney safety?

Establishing a consistent preventative maintenance schedule is the most effective strategy for maintaining a safe and efficient fireplace in Hatfield, PA. Industry standards recommend having your chimney inspected annually and swept whenever soot or creosote buildup reaches one-eighth of an inch in thickness. Estimated Chimney Service Frequencies and Cost Ranges for Hatfield, PA Homes
Chimney Service TypeRecommended FrequencyTypical Cost Range (Hatfield, PA)
Level 1 Inspection & SweepAnnually / Once per year$180 - $350
Level 2 Video InspectionReal estate transfer or after severe weather$250 - $500
Custom Chimney Cap InstallationAs needed (lasts 10-20 years)$300 - $750
Flue Repair & ReliningAs needed / Upon inspection finding$1,200 - $3,500
Masonry WaterproofingEvery 3 to 5 years$250 - $600

Frequently Asked Questions

How often should homeowners in Hatfield, PA schedule a routine chimney sweep?

Homeowners in Hatfield, PA should schedule a professional chimney sweep at least once a year, or as soon as creosote accumulation reaches one-eighth of an inch. Regular annual cleaning prevents dangerous chimney fires and removes corrosive soot before it damages your flue lining during humid Pennsylvania summers.

What are the common signs that my Hatfield, PA fireplace has a creosote buildup?

Common signs of dangerous creosote buildup in Hatfield, PA homes include a strong tar-like odor coming from the fireplace, flaky black deposits inside the smoke chamber, and sluggish drafting when burning wood. Catching these warning signs early prevents chimney fires and protects your living space.

Why is moisture such a damaging enemy to chimneys in Hatfield, PA?

Moisture is destructive in Hatfield, PA because local freeze-thaw cycles cause trapped water inside brick mortar joints to expand and crack masonry. Routine waterproof sealing and proper chimney cap installation keep rain out and preserve the structural integrity of your flue system.

How do I know if my Hatfield, PA chimney needs a Level 1 or Level 2 inspection?

A Level 1 inspection is suitable for Hatfield, PA chimneys with routine annual maintenance and no operational changes. A Level 2 video inspection is required if you are buying a home, experiencing drafting issues, or after a severe weather event or chimney fire.
